没有合适的资源?快使用搜索试试~ 我知道了~
首页51单片机驱动的高效抢答器设计研究
本文档是一篇关于基于51单片机的抢答器设计的毕业论文。作者针对现有抢答器存在的问题,如使用不便、制作复杂、可靠性不高以及设备易损导致更换不及时等,结合所学的计算机专业知识,设计了一款更为实用的抢答器系统。论文首先阐述了设计背景和技术挑战,强调了随着科技发展,人们对于便捷高效的知识学习工具的需求。 在设计过程中,论文详细描述了51单片机的选择和使用,作为核心控制单元,它能实现快速反应和精确判断,确保抢答过程的公平性和实时性。可能涉及的技术环节包括硬件电路设计、编码与解码电路、中断处理机制、按键识别算法等,这些都是为了优化用户体验,提高抢答系统的稳定性和易用性。 论文还可能讨论了抢答器的用户界面设计,包括简洁明了的操作提示和计分显示功能,以及如何通过无线通信技术(如蓝牙或Wi-Fi)连接到中央控制系统,实现远程操作和数据传输。此外,为了提高设备耐用性,可能探讨了对电路保护措施和环境适应性的考虑。 在软件开发方面,除了编写控制程序,还可能涉及到嵌入式操作系统的选择和应用,以及对错误处理和异常检测的策略。同时,论文会强调代码的可维护性和模块化设计,以便于后期的升级和维护。 论文的结论部分可能会总结设计成果的优势,如成本效益、性能提升、以及对比传统抢答器的改进之处。最后,参考文献部分会列出在设计过程中参考的相关学术资料和技术文档,展示作者的研究深度和广度。 这篇论文不仅关注硬件技术的应用,还涵盖了系统设计、软件开发、用户体验和实际应用等多个层面,是一篇结合理论与实践,具有一定创新价值的计算机科学作品。
资源详情
资源推荐
目 录
摘要 ........................................................................................................................I
ABSTRACT ..........................................................................................................II
第一章 绪论..........................................................................................................2
1.1 单片机抢答器的相关背景...................................................................2
1.2 单片机抢答器的意义...........................................................................2
1.3 抢答器的应用.........................................................................................2
第二章 系统主要硬件及功能介绍....................................................................4
2.1 80C51 特殊功能寄存器 ..........................................................................4
2.2 80C51 单片机的功能 ..............................................................................5
2.3 80C51 单片机 ..........................................................................................5
2.4 抢答器的优点和组成.............................................................................6
2.5 系统的工作流程.....................................................................................7
第三章 硬件电路设计..........................................................................................8
3.1 总体设计..................................................................................................8
3.1.1 总体原理图...........................................................................................8
3.2 按钮输入电路的设计..............................................................................9
3.3 显示电路的设计....................................................................................10
3.4 复位电路的设计....................................................................................10
3.5 时钟频率的设计...................................................................................11
3.6 发声........................................................................................................11
第四章 软件电路设计......................................................................................12
4.1 抢答流程图............................................................................................12
4.2 系统程序................................................................................................13
4.2.1 查询程序....................................................................................14
4.2.1 正常抢答处理程序.....................................................................15
4.2.3 显示程序.....................................................................................16
4.2.4 非法抢答处理程序....................................................................17
4.2.5 犯规抢答程序.............................................................................18
4.2.6 抢答时间调整程序....................................................................18
4.2.7 倒计时程序................................................................................20
4.2.8 发声程序.....................................................................................21
4.2.9 加减时间延时.............................................................................22
第五章 调试及性能分析....................................................................................23
结束语..................................................................................................................24
参考文献..............................................................................................................25
2
第一章 绪论
1.1 单片机抢答器的相关背景
抢答器是一种应用非常广泛的设备,在各种竞赛、抢答场合中,它能迅速、客观地分辨出
最先获得发言权的选手。早期的抢答器只由几个三极管、可控硅、发光管等组成,
能通过发光管的指示辩认出选手号码。现在大多数抢答器均使用单片机和数字集
成电路,并增加了许多新功能,如选手号码显示、抢按前或抢按后的计时等功能,本课
题利用 8 0 C 5 1单片机及外围接口实现的抢答系统,利用单片机的定时器/计数器定
时和记数的原理,将软、硬件有机地结合起来,使得系统能够正确地进行计时,
同时使数码管能够正确地显示时间和选手号码。扬声器发生提示。系统达到要求:
在抢答中,只有开始后抢答限定时间和回答问题的时间可是在 1- 9 9 s 抢答才有
效,如果在开始抢答前抢答为无效;设定;正确按键后有音乐提示;抢答时间和回
答问题时间倒记时显示,时间完后系统自动复位。
1.2 单片机抢答器的意义
本系统采用单片机作为整个控制核心。控制系统的四个模块为:显示模块、存储
模块、语音模块、抢答开关模块。该系统通过开关电路四个按键输入抢答信号;
利用一个数码管来完成显示功能;用按键来让选手进行抢答,在数码管上显示哪
一组先答题的,从而实现整个抢答过程。在知识比赛中, 特别是做抢答题目的
时候, 在抢答过程中,为了知道哪一组或哪一位选手先答题,必须要设计一个
系统来完成这个任务。如果在抢答中,靠视觉是很难判断出哪组先答题。利用单
片机系统来设计抢答器,使以上问题得以解决,即使两组的抢答时间相差几微秒,
也可分辨出哪组优先答题。本文主要介绍了单片机抢答器设计及工作原理,以及
它的实际用途。系统工作原理本系统采用 80C51 单片机作为核心。控制系统的
四个模块分别为:存储模块、显示模块、语音模块、抢答开关模块。该抢答器系
统通过开关电路四个按键输入抢答信号; 利用一个数码管来完成显示功能。工
作时,用按键通过开关电路输入各路的抢答信号,经单片机的处理, 输出控制
信号,单片机控制的智能抢答器设计。
1.3 抢答器的应用
随着我国经济和文化事业的发展,在很多公开竞争场合要求有公正的竞争裁决,
诸如证券、股票交易及各种智力竞赛等,因此出现了抢答器。抢答器一般是由很
多电路组成的,线路复杂,可靠性不高,功能也比较简单,特别是当抢答路数很
多时,实现起来就更为困难。因此我们设计了以单片机为核心的新型智能的抢答
器,在保留了原始抢答器的基本功能的同时又增加一系列的实用功能并简化其电
剩余30页未读,继续阅读
Mmnnnbb123
- 粉丝: 718
- 资源: 8万+
上传资源 快速赚钱
- 我的内容管理 收起
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
会员权益专享
最新资源
- Simulink在电机控制仿真中的应用
- 电子警察:功能、结构与抓拍原理详解
- TESSY 4.1 英文用户手册:Razorcat Development GmbH
- 5V12V直流稳压电源设计及其实现
- 江西建工四建来宾市消防支队高支模施工方案
- 三维建模教程:创建足球模型
- 宏福苑南二区公寓楼施工组织设计
- 福建外运集团信息化建设技术方案:网络与业务平台设计
- 打造理想工作环境:详尽的6S推行指南
- 阿里巴巴数据中台建设与实践
- 欧姆龙CP1H PLC操作手册:SYSMACCP系列详解
- 中国移动统一DPI设备技术规范:LTE数据合成服务器关键功能详解
- 高校竞赛信息管理系统:软件设计与体系详解
- 面向对象设计:准则、启发规则与系统分解
- 程序设计基础与算法解析
- 算法与程序设计基础概览
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功